Top Oscars Moments
by AsiaOne | 2:39 AM CDT, March 09, 2010
SANDRA Bullock is the first actress to have won both an Oscar and a Golden Raspberry Award (also known as a Razzie, which celebrates the worst in film) in the same year. Yesterday, she took home the Oscar for Best Actress for her role in The Blind Side
